In June, Department of Correction Commissioner Louis Molina submitted an action plan to the federal judge overseeing the troubled city agency with a key proposal to hire additional civilian staffers to do paperwork so officers can return to guarding detainees. Field representatives handle prisoner and staff complaints, investigate suicides, homicides and other violent and unusual incidents, and help to smooth the delivery of basic services and to calm tensions in the facilities. We write to express our concern over recent reports and documents demonstrating that Department of Correction (DOC) officers were cooperating with federal immigration enforcement officials to facilitate the arrest of immigrant New Yorkers being released from custody. Molina decreed that board investigators had to come to DOC headquarters to view video between 9 a.m. and 6 p.m. on weekdays, and could not print out images or take documentation with them, records show. Molina and his team, though, havent hired a single new civilian employee or detailed any jobs that are available since the action plan was submitted in Manhattan federal court on June 14, according to multiple correction sources and city records. The e-mail evidence suggests several instances of DOC officials communicating with ICE regarding individuals in DOC custody that did not have a conviction for a qualifying offense. In 2014, New York City signed into law strict parameters detailing when DOC will honor an ICE request to detain an individual 48 hours beyond their scheduled release.
